We receive worksheets from other divisions that have the paper size set to Letter. This affects how the pages print out on A4 paper. Is there an easy way to convert all the sheets in a workbook to the A4 paper size?

By Neale Blackwood

The macro below will adjust the paper size to A4 for every sheet in the active workbook.

Sub A4Paper()
Dim sht As Worksheet

For Each sht In Sheets
sht.PageSetup.PaperSize = xlPaperA4
Next sht
End Sub

